Patient's Query

Hello doctor,

Thank you for the reply.

The doctor put me on Cimetidine. How long should it take this to make my symptoms better? Kindly help.

Hi,

Welcome back to icliniq.com.

Tablet Cimetidine, if effective, will show the effect within ten days. I really doubt it as the tablet Lansoprazole is a proton pump inhibitor (PPI) while Cimetidine is an H2 blocker. PPI shows better results than H2 blockers. But the result can vary from person to person.
